Transcribed by Jonathan Laing
Aaron Matteson to Verbadus & Leban Matteson
Dated March 24, 1837
Source: West Greenwich Land Records, pages 235-236
Know all men by these present that I Aaron Matteson of West Greenwich in the County of Kent and State
of Rhode Island. In consideration of the sum of thirty dollars to me paid by Verbadus Matteson and
Laban W. Matteson of the same West Greenwich, the receipt whereof I do hereby acknowledge, do
hereby give grant sell and convey unto the said Verbadus Matteson and Laban W. Matteson, their heirs
and assigns forever one certain tract of land lying in West Greenwich aforesaid Containing by estimation
twenty acres be the same more or less. Bounded as follows Viz beginning at a maple tree at the highway
near Ishmael Briggs (so called) and thence running westerly along said highway Sixty Eight rods to a
fence between the meadow and pasture, thence running Southerly along said fence, thirty rods then
running easterly to an apple tree fifty rods , from that to the nearest place of the great river twenty
seven rods thence down along the great river to the first mentioned Bound with a house standing
thereon to have and to hold the same to the said Verbadus Matteson and Laban W. Matteson, their heirs
and assigns to them and their use and be hoof forever. And I do covenant with the said Verbadus
Matteson and Laban W. Matteson their heirs and assigns that I am lawfully seized in fee of the premises
they are free of all incumbencies that I have good right to sell and convey the same, to the said Verbadus
Matteson and Laban W. Matteson, and that I will warrant and defend the same to the said Verbadus and Laban W. their heirs and assigns forever; against the law full claims and demands of all persons.
Provided nevertheless and the condition of the above written instrument to such that if I the said Aaron
Matteson my heirs executors or administrators shall well and truly pay or come to be paid to the said
Verbadus and Laban W. Matteson their heirs, executors or administrators or assigns the full and just
sum of thirty dollars on or before the twenty fourth day of March which shall be in the year of our Lord,
one thousand eight hundred and thirty eight together with lawful interest for the same until paid then
the above written deed of also a certain note bearing even date with these present is given by me to the
said Verbadus Matteson and Laban W. Matteson for the payment of the sum aforesaid with interest at
the time aforesaid, shall be void, otherwise shall be and remains in full force and virtue.
In witness whereof I have here unto set my hand and seal this 24th day of March in the Year of our Lord
one thousand eight hundred and thirty seven, and of American independence
Signed sealed and delivered
In presence of ?
Joseph Hoxsie Aaron Matteson
Benjamin R Hoxsie
Recd this deed to record Kent JC March 24, 1837 then the above named
March 24, 1837 at 6 O clock Aaron Matteson, at West Greenwich, personally
In the afternoon appearing acknowledged the above written
Recorded same instrument to be his voluntary act and deed
Day by before me
Benjamin R Hoxsie Benjamin R. Hoxsie T Clk
Additional note written on side of document
West Greenwich March 20th AD 1840
Then received of the heirs of Aaron Matteson deceased the sum of thirty five dollars and thirty eight
cents in full discharge of principle and interest due on this mortgage in witness whereof I have here unto
set my hand and seal
Verbadus Matteson
